Subversion Repositories wimsdev

Rev

Rev 13716 | Go to most recent revision | Details | Compare with Previous | Last modification | View Log | RSS feed

Rev Author Line No. Line
11375 bpr 1
type=question
23 reyssat 2
textarea="datatrue datafalse explain"
13716 obado 3
iEdit="explain"
13749 obado 4
asis="explain"
23 reyssat 5
 
12167 mquerol 6
:Triar les frases certes d'una llista proposada.
7
Es proposa una llista amb un cert nombre de frases. S'han d'identificar i marcar les que són certes. Les frases certes i les falses es trien a l'atzar de les respectives llistes. El nombre de frases certes a cada presentació no és sempre el mateix.
23 reyssat 8
<p>
12167 mquerol 9
Com més dades (en aquest cas, frases) hi poseu, més aleatori i repetible serà l'exercici. Però també podeu fer exercicis només amb les frases que necessiteu. Serà en aquest cas un QCM
10
amb diverses opcions correctes.
13476 obado 11
<p class="wims_credits">
12167 mquerol 12
Autor del model : Gang Xiao <qualite@wimsedu.info>
23 reyssat 13
 
14
:%%%%%%%%%%%%%%%%%      ATTENTION      %%%%%%%%%%%%%%%%%%%%
15
 
2880 bpr 16
Enlevez l'en-tête ci-dessus si vous détruisez les balises pour le modèle !
23 reyssat 17
(Ce sont les lignes qui commencent par un ':'.)
18
Sinon l'exercice risque de ne pas pouvoir repasser sous Createxo.
19
 
20
:%%%%%%%% Paramètres d'exemples à redéfinir %%%%%%%%%%%%%%%%%
21
 
12167 mquerol 22
:\title{Cert/fals múltiple}
5147 bpr 23
:\author{XIAO, Gang}
8002 bpr 24
:\email{qualite@wimsedu.info}
6132 bpr 25
:\credits{}
23 reyssat 26
 
12167 mquerol 27
:Nombre de frases a presentar
23 reyssat 28
\integer{tot=4}
29
 
12167 mquerol 30
:Mínim de frases certes en cada exercici presentat. Almenys 1
23 reyssat 31
\integer{mintrue=1}
32
 
12167 mquerol 33
:Mínim de frases falses en cada exercici presentat. Almenys 1
23 reyssat 34
\integer{minfalse=1}
35
 
12167 mquerol 36
:Frases certes. Una per línia, no poseu punt i coma.
37
Eviteu frases llargues!
23 reyssat 38
$embraced_randitem
39
\matrix{datatrue=
3426 bpr 40
À tension égale, le courant passant par un résistor est inversement proportionnel à sa résistance.
41
À courant égal, la tension sur un résistor est proportionnelle à sa résistance.
23 reyssat 42
Le courant passant par un résistor est proportionnel à la tension appliquée.
43
La puissance dissipée par un résistor est proportionnelle au carré de la tension appliquée.
44
La puissance dissipée par un résistor est proportionnelle au carré du courant.
3426 bpr 45
À tension alternative égale, le courant passant par un condensateur est proportionnel à la capacité.
46
À courant égal, la tension alternative sur un condensateur est inversement proportionnelle à la capacité.
47
À tension alternative égale, le courant passant par un solénoïde est inversement proportionnel à l'inductance.
48
À courant égal, la tension alternative sur un solénoïde est proportionnelle à l'inductance.
23 reyssat 49
Un condensateur idéal ne consomme pas d'énergie.
50
Un solénoïde idéal ne consomme pas d'énergie.
51
}
52
 
12167 mquerol 53
:Frases falses. Una per línia, no poseu punt i coma.
54
Eviteu frases llargues!
23 reyssat 55
$embraced_randitem
56
\matrix{datafalse=
3426 bpr 57
À tension égale, le courant passant par un résistor est proportionnel à sa résistance.
58
À courant égal, la tension sur un résistor est inversement proportionnelle à sa résistance.
59
À courant égal, la tension sur un résistor est indépendante de sa résistance.
60
À tension égale, le courant passant par un résistor est indépendant de sa résistance.
23 reyssat 61
Le courant passant par une diode est proportionnel à la tension appliquée.
62
La puissance dissipée par un résistor est proportionnelle à la tension appliquée.
63
La puissance dissipée par un résistor est proportionnelle au courant.
3426 bpr 64
À tension alternative égale, le courant passant par un condensateur est inversement proportionnel à la capacité.
65
À courant égal, la tension alternative sur un condensateur est proportionnelle à la capacité.
66
À tension alternative égale, le courant passant par un condensateur est indépendant de la capacité.
67
À tension continue égale, le courant passant par un condensateur est proportionnel à la capacité.
68
À courant égal, la tension continue sur un condensateur est inversement proportionnelle à la capacité.
69
À courant égal, la tension alternative sur un condensateur est indépendante de la capacité.
70
À tension alternative égale, le courant passant par un solénoïde est proportionnel à l'inductance.
71
À courant égal, la tension alternative sur un solénoïde est inversement proportionnelle à l'inductance.
23 reyssat 72
La puissance dissipée par un condensateur est proportionnelle {à,au carré de} la tension appliquée.
73
La puissance dissipée par un condensateur est proportionnelle {au,au carré du} courant.
74
La puissance dissipée par un solénoïde idéal est proportionnelle {à,au carré de} la tension appliquée.
75
La puissance dissipée par un solénoïde idéal est proportionnelle {au,au carré du} courant.
76
}
77
 
12167 mquerol 78
:Opcions
79
Afegiu la paraula  <span class="tt wims_code_words">split</span> a la definició si voleu donar una nota
80
parcial per a respostes parcialment correctes.
23 reyssat 81
\text{option=split}
82
 
12167 mquerol 83
:Enunciat
23 reyssat 84
$embraced_randitem
13749 obado 85
\text{explain=asis(Quines de les següents afirmacions són certes? Marqueu-les.)}
23 reyssat 86
 
12167 mquerol 87
:S'accepta text aleatori posat entre claus
6132 bpr 88
$embraced_randitem
12167 mquerol 89
\text{accolade=item(1,1 sí,
90
2 no)}
6132 bpr 91
 
12167 mquerol 92
:%%%%%%%%%%%%%% Nothing to modify before the statement %%%%%%%%%%%%%%%%
23 reyssat 93
 
6132 bpr 94
\text{accolade=wims(word 1 of \accolade)}
23 reyssat 95
\text{datatrue=wims(nonempty rows \datatrue)}
96
\text{datafalse=wims(nonempty rows \datafalse)}
97
\integer{truecnt=rows(\datatrue)}
98
\integer{falsecnt=rows(\datafalse)}
99
\integer{tot=\tot > min(\truecnt,\falsecnt)?min(\truecnt,\falsecnt)}
100
\integer{mintrue=\mintrue<1?1}
101
\integer{minfalse=\minfalse<1?1}
102
\integer{mintrue=\mintrue>\tot-1?\tot-1}
103
\integer{minfalse=\minfalse>\tot-1?\tot-1}
104
\integer{tot<\mintrue+\minfalse?\mintrue+\minfalse}
105
\text{tsh=shuffle(\truecnt)}
106
\text{fsh=shuffle(\falsecnt)}
107
\text{true=row(\tsh,\datatrue)}
108
\text{false=row(\fsh,\datafalse)}
109
\integer{truepick=randint(\mintrue..\tot-\minfalse)}
110
\text{pick=row(1..\truepick,\true);row(1..\tot-\truepick,\false)}
111
\text{ind=wims(makelist 1 for x=1 to \truepick),wims(makelist 0 for x=1 to \tot-\truepick)}
112
 
113
\text{sh=shuffle(\tot)}
114
\text{ind=item(\sh,\ind)}
115
\text{pick=row(\sh,\pick)}
6132 bpr 116
\text{pick=\accolade=1 ? wims(embraced randitem \pick)}
23 reyssat 117
\text{ans=positionof(1,\ind)}
118
\text{list=wims(values x for x=1 to \tot)}
6132 bpr 119
\text{explain=\accolade=1 ? wims(embraced randitem \explain)}
23 reyssat 120
 
12167 mquerol 121
:%%%%%%%%%%%%% Now the statement in html. %%%%%%%%%%%%%%%%%%%%
23 reyssat 122
 
12167 mquerol 123
::You don't need to modify this in general.
23 reyssat 124
 
12167 mquerol 125
\statement{
126
<div class="instruction">
127
\explain
128
</div>
129
<ul style="list-style-type:none">
23 reyssat 130
\for{i=1 to \tot}{
12167 mquerol 131
 <li>
132
  \embed{reply 1,\i}. &nbsp;\pick[\i;]
133
  </li>
23 reyssat 134
}
12167 mquerol 135
</ul>
23 reyssat 136
}
137
 
12167 mquerol 138
:%%%%%%%%%%%%% Nothing to modify after. %%%%%%%%%%%%%%%%%
23 reyssat 139
 
12167 mquerol 140
\answer{The reply}{\ans;\list}{type=checkbox}{option=\option}